Muscat de Samos

Wine produced in the island of Samos from the native wine of Muscat Blanc à Petits Grains. Grapes are cultivated on traditional terraces characterized by old stone walls, so-called “pezoule”. The terraces are located close to the slopes of Mountain Ampelos and reach 900 meters above sea level. The wine is pale, greenish and bright, with an elegant nose with floral and fruity aromas. Clear references to muscat, which is expressed in a refined way without showing muscles, fresh acid and quite persistent.
